EDITORS COMMENTS
This engraving captures the essence of Anton Rubinstein, a renowned Russian pianist, composer, and conductor. Created by Edward Linley Sambourne in 1881 for Punch magazine, this satirical cartoon showcases Rubinstein's musical prowess and enigmatic personality. In this image, we see Rubinstein seated at a grand piano, his fingers gracefully dancing across the keys. The artist skillfully portrays him as a demonic figure engulfed in an aura of music and passion. This depiction reflects both his virtuosity on the piano and his reputation for delivering powerful performances that left audiences spellbound. Rubinstein's contribution to classical music is undeniable. As one of Russia's most celebrated composers, he composed numerous symphonies, operas, and chamber works that continue to be performed today. His talent extended beyond composition; he was also highly regarded as a conductor who brought out the best from orchestras around the world. The artist's attention to detail is evident in every stroke of this engraving. From Rubinstein's intense gaze to the intricate rendering of his hands on the keyboard, it beautifully captures his dedication and commitment to his craft. This print serves as a testament to Rubinstein's enduring legacy in the world of music. It reminds us not only of his extraordinary talent but also of his ability to captivate audiences with every note he played.
